1. The four main categories of stars are:

O-type stars: These are the hottest and most massive stars. They are extremely bright and have surface temperatures of more than 30,000 K.B-type stars: These stars are slightly cooler and less massive than O-type stars. They have surface temperatures of around 10,000 K and are also very bright.A-type stars: These stars are cooler and less massive than B-type stars. They have surface temperatures of around 7,500 K and are relatively bright.M-type stars: These stars are the coolest and least massive of the four categories. They have surface temperatures of less than 3,500 K and are not very bright.

2. In general, O-type stars are the largest and most luminous, while M-type stars are the smallest and least luminous. B-type and A-type stars fall in between these two extremes in terms of size, brightness, and temperature. However, there is a lot of variation within each of these categories, and there is not a hard and fast rule for how these characteristics relate to one another. The size, brightness, and temperature of a star depend on a variety of factors, including its mass, age, and composition.

How the thermal energy of water changes as it goes through each of the six phase changes that happen on Earth (you can group melting, evaporation and sublimation together as well as freezing, condensation, and deposition)

Answers

Answer:

Any phase change that takes you from higher energy particles to lower energy particles is exothermic.

Similarly, any phase change that takes you from lower energy particles to higher energy particles is endothermic.

The idea here is that in order to change the state of a substance you must either provide with energy or take away energy.

When you're going from particles that are in a lower energetic state to particles that are in a higher energetic state, you must provide energy.

This implies that the process will be endothermic since heat must be absorbed. You will thus have -- I'll ignore plasma here and stick to the traditional phase changes

solid to liquid →melting→requires an energy liquid to gas →evaporation→requires energy solid to gas →sublimation→requires an energy

When you're going from particles that are in a higher energy state to particles that are in a lower energy state, you must take away energy.

This implies that the process will be exothermic since heat is being released. You will thus have

gas to liquid →condensation→gives off a energy liquid to solid →freezing→gives off an energy gas to solid →deposition→gives off an energy

And there you have it -- six phase changes, three exothermic and three endothermic correspond to the three traditional phases of matter, liquid, solid, and gas.

There are four states of matter in the universe: plasma, gas, liquid and solid. But, matter on Earth exists mostly in three distinct phases: gas, liquid and solid. A phase is a distinctive form of a substance, and matter can change among the phases. It may take extreme temperature, pressure or energy, but all matter can be changed.

There are six distinct changes of phase which happens to different substances at different temperatures. The six changes are:

Freezing: the substance changes from a liquid to a solid.
Melting: the substance changes back from the solid to the liquid.
Condensation: the substance changes from a gas to a liquid.
Vaporization: the substance changes from a liquid to a gas.
Sublimation: the substance changes directly from a solid to a gas without going through the liquid phase.
Deposition: the substance changes directly from a gas to a solid without going through the liquid phase.

While standing water in the streets and sewers (option A) and poor water quality in rivers and streams (option D) may persist for some time after the flood, they are generally considered short-term changes as they can eventually be remedied through clean-up efforts and restoration programs.

Temporary displacement of organisms (option B) can also be considered a short-term change, as organisms will eventually return to their original habitats once conditions improve.

However, a permanent change in the landscape (option C) such as altered river channels, new water bodies, or changes in topography, can have lasting effects on the ecosystem and its inhabitants. These changes may alter habitat suitability, nutrient cycling, and water availability, which can impact the ecosystem for years or even decades to come.
